Meatloaf

Tonight we are having Meatloaf, broccoli and cheese rice, corn and rolls. I'm going to share my mom's recipe for meatloaf and give you a step by step view of making it.

Here's the recipe:
1.5 lbs ground beef
1/2 c ketchup plus enough to cover the top
1 small onion diced plus 1/2 small onion sliced
8 saltine crackers crumbled
almost 1/4 c milk
salt
pepper

In a large bowl add ground beef, 1/2 c ketchup, diced onion, crackers, and milk. Sprinkle with salt to your liking, I go over it twice with the salt shaker and then put a light coating of pepper on top. Mix everything together until blended... be sure to squeeze the meat as you're mixing so that it makes into a loaf. Place the loaf into an ungreased glass dish. Add a layer of ketchup on top. Place the sliced onions around the outside, they will cook in the juices that come out of the loaf. Place in a 350 degree oven for 1 hour. I serve with brown gravy, but it isn't necessary. Enjoy!
